All Elite Wrestling’s (AEW) Friday night showcase, AEW Rampage, has rapidly become a must-watch event for wrestling enthusiasts around the world. Known for its high-octane action and compelling storylines, Rampage often delivers matches that leave fans on the edge of their seats. Tonight’s episode is already shaping up to be another blockbuster. AEW has confirmed three electrifying matches: a star-studded 8-man tag team clash with Daniel Garcia, Jake Hager, Matt Menard, and Angelo Parker taking on The Hardys (Matt & Jeff Hardy) teamed up with Best Friends (Chuck Taylor & Trent Beretta). The women’s division promises fireworks too, as Hikaru Shida & Kris Statlander gear up to face Marina Shafir & Nyla Rose. Not to be outdone, a thrilling Number One Contender’s Match for the ROH World Championship is on the cards, featuring Komander, Johnny TV, Penta El Zero Miedo, and Lince Dorado.
